Summaryinfo

A vulnerability labeled as critical has been found in klaussilveira Gitlist up to 0.6. This issue affects the function searchTree. Such manipulation as part of POST Request leads to input validation. This vulnerability is listed as CVE-2018-1000533. The attack may be performed from remote. There is no available exploit. It is advisable to implement a patch to correct this issue.

Detailsinfo

A vulnerability was found in klaussilveira Gitlist up to 0.6 and classified as critical. Affected by this issue is the function searchTree. The manipulation as part of a POST Request leads to a input validation v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-20. The product receives input or data, but it does not validate or incorrectly validates that the input has the properties that are required to process the data safely and correctly.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

klaussilveira GitList version <= 0.6 contains a Passing incorrectly sanitized input to system function vulnerability in `searchTree` function that can result in Execute any code as PHP user. This attack appear to be exploitable via Send POST request using search form. This vulnerability appears to have been fixed in 0.7 after commit 87b8c26b023c3fc37f0796b14bb13710f397b322.

The bug was discovered 04/24/2018. The weakness was presented 06/26/2018 (Website). The advisory is shared for download at github.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2018-1000533 since 06/22/2018.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be launched remotely. No form of authentication is required for exploitation. There are known technical details, but no exploit is available.

It is declared as highly functional. The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 63 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$0-$5k.

Applying the patch 87b8c26b023c3fc37f0796b14bb13710f397b322 is able to eliminate this problem.
